1. Prayer for the Deceased Soul’s Eternal Rest

It is a heavy burden to know someone you cared for has passed away. You might feel a deep sadness and worry about their eternal peace. This prayer is for those moments when you want to ask God to grant rest and light to the soul of the departed, trusting in His infinite mercy.

Bible Verse

“And I heard a voice from heaven saying unto me, Write, Blessed are the dead which die in the Lord from henceforth: Yea, saith the Spirit, that they may rest from their labours; and their works do follow them.” — Revelation 14:13

Prayer

Heavenly Father, we commend Your departed servant into Your hands. Grant them eternal rest and let Your perpetual light shine upon them. May they find peace in Your loving embrace and be welcomed into Your heavenly kingdom. We trust in Your boundless mercy and love for all Your children. Amen.

2. Prayer for Comfort for the Grieving Family

When someone dies, their family and friends are left to navigate a sea of grief. You might feel lost, heartbroken, and unsure how to move forward. This prayer is for you, seeking God’s gentle comfort and strength to help you through this painful time.

Bible Verse

“The Lord is nigh unto them that are of a broken heart; and saveth such as be of a contrite spirit.” — Psalm 34:18

Prayer

Lord Jesus, we lift up all those who are grieving the loss of a loved one. Wrap them in Your divine comfort and peace. Ease their sorrow, strengthen their hearts, and remind them that they are not alone. May they feel Your presence surrounding them, offering hope and healing. Amen.

16. Prayer for the Departed’s Freedom from Purgatory

In Catholic belief, some souls may need purification after death. This prayer is for those who believe the departed may be in purgatory, asking God to hasten their purification and bring them to heaven.

Bible Verse

“For he hath not despised nor abhorred the affliction of the afflicted; neither hath he hid his face from him; but when he cried unto him, he heard.” — Psalm 22:24

Prayer

Merciful God, we pray for the soul of Your departed servant, who may be undergoing purification. Release them from any temporal punishment due to sin. Hasten their journey to heaven and grant them the grace of Your immediate presence. Amen.
